Vladimir Motin had been on sole watch duty when the Solong collided with the Stena Immaculate anchored near the Humber Estuary in Yorkshire on March 10 last year.
Vladimir Motin, 59, was on sole watch duty when his vessel smashed into the US oil tanker the Stena Immaculate, causing the death of Mark Angelo Pernia, 38.
Vladimir Motin, 59, appeared at the Old Bailey in London via video link from HMP Hull. Assisted by a Russian interpreter, he spoke only to confirm his name and plead not guilty to manslaughter.
